Diamond Path Lace - A pattern to make a shawl, scarf, cowl and mobius loop.
Many folks have made my Garter Stitch Diamond Lace shawl and have asked for a scarf version. Now you can knit this easy lace pattern and make a 6 inch wide flat scarf, cowl or mobius. With more repeats, you can make a shawl the desired width and length you need.
For the sample shown, I used No. 3 (US) needles with Red Heart Fashion Crochet thread (100% cotton) Size 3, 125 yards. Using the entire ball, this produced a strip approximately 26 inches long and 6 inches wide. This length is suitable for a mobius or cowl. 3 balls would make a scarf just over 6 feet long.
Gauge: Not too important! Use the yarn and needle combo that not only works with how loose or tight you knit but also results in good looking lace. Yardage of yarn/thread depends on how long and wide you decide to make your garment.
You can make this easy to knit garment in any weight yarn.
